It's Time To Chill (1996) |
|
|
|
|
Saturday, 06 January 1996 00:40 |
Well it's been short , But it's been good, And it's been full of wholesome fun, Well no more dog food in the grill, Grandpa Rover it's time to chill.
I know Grandma Ranger's gonna cry, Her tail won't wag with as much vigour, But I guess sooner or later she'll understand, That she'll have to do without her Rover, Yes sometime soon- she'll realise that it's over.
Remember always the rabbit chases, The three star chicken bones from Uncle Jay, Remember your tailwag and your pawshake, And whether you're happy, sulky or sad, Remember the only family you've ever had.
Well chill in peace, Don't bark too much, Wag your tail if you must, If we meet some day at Heaven's door, I'll remember to shake you by the paw.
© Fungai James Tichawangana (To Rover- chill in peace forever) Troutbeck, Nyanga Saturday 6 January 1996 0040hrs
